The following special admission requirements apply to the Master’s program in Art History:
a) a first professionally qualifying degree in the Bachelor’s program in Art History at the
University of Hamburg or in a comparable program at another university.
b) Proficiency in English and another modern foreign language corresponding to reference
level B1 of the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R). Proof
of language proficiency is not required if the applicant is a first language speaker.
c) Secured knowledge of Latin (“Kleines Latinum”). If Latin knowledge is not documented in
the school certificate, appropriate evidence of successful participation in a grammar
course and a reading course, e.g., in the Latin courses I–II of the Faculty of Humanities,
shall be deemed equivalent. Knowledge of Latin can be supplemented by another
foreign language corresponding to the reference level.
B1 of the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R).
Proof of language skills must be provided at the latest when registering for the Master’s
thesis.
All applicants who did not complete their undergraduate degree at a German-speaking university must demonstrate sufficient German language proficiency for enrollment (not yet for application).
Recognition of Certificates for Degrees Obtained Abroad
For applicants who earned their first degree abroad, the recognition of a degree obtained abroad will be processed as part of the faculty's application process.
What to prepare for your application to Art History
Application documents to be submitted
Please ensure that your application is complete! Please submit all documents as uncertified copies. For documents not issued in German or English, a certified translation is also required.

If you are still studying at the time of application and cannot provide a degree certificate with a grade, please submit a current transcript of records with a provisional average grade. If you have any outstanding academic achievements, please provide a table listing them, including the number of ECTS credits. The degree certificate must be submitted by the end of the first master's semester.
``` • PLEASE ALSO SUBMIT THE FOLLOWING DOCUMENTS: - CV - Letter of motivation (1 page)
Note: Please refrain from submitting any documents not expressly requested (e.g., references, writing samples, letters of recommendation).

In addition to mailing, you can also submit your application directly to the institute. A mailbox is located in front of the office (Room 117).
Alternatively, you can also submit your application digitally. In this case, please send your documents by the deadline to: [email protected].
The complete application documents must be received by the application address by the application deadline; otherwise, your application cannot be considered. This is a deadline; an extension is not possible.
If submitted by mail, the date of receipt is valid, not the postmark!
If you are also submitting a special application (e.g., a hardship application), this must be submitted separately from the above-mentioned application documents, including the required supporting documents, directly
via the online application within the application deadline. You upload the documents for the special application within the online application; sending them by mail is not permitted.
